Subject: mm: factor out large folio handling from folio_nr_pages() into folio_large_nr_pages()
Date: Mon, 3 Mar 2025 17:29:55 +0100

Let's factor it out into a simple helper function.  This helper will also
come in handy when working with code where we know that our folio is
large.

While at it, let's consistently return a "long" value from all these
similar functions.  Note that we cannot use "unsigned int" (even though
_folio_nr_pages is of that type), because it would break some callers that
do stuff like "-folio_nr_pages()".  Both "int" or "unsigned long" would
work as well.

Maybe in the future we'll have the nr_pages readily available for all
large folios, maybe even for small folios, or maybe for none.
